Chartered Legal Executive Business & Commercial Employment

Amber is a Fellow of the Chartered Institute of Legal Executives and works in our Business & Commercial department. Amber advises employees and employers in connection with a range of employment disputes and assists with achieving their desired outcomes. She specialises in constructive/unfair dismissals, discrimination and whistleblowing complaints.
